European University Institute Library

Palgrave Macmillan, Hampshire, England, 2003-

Date
2003-
Label
Palgrave Macmillan, Hampshire, England, 2003-
Name
Palgrave Macmillan
Place
Hampshire, England
Provider agent
Provider place

Incoming Resources

Outgoing Resources